TL;DR
Senior Software Developer (Java/React): Guiding the transformation of a legacy desktop trading platform into a modern web-based solution with an accent on developing a new React/Redux frontend and enhancing the Java backend. Focus on architectural standards, best practices, and delivering a scalable, high-performance, and maintainable user interface for financial services.
Location: Hybrid in Edinburgh, United Kingdom
Company
hirify.global fosters a collaborative, engaging, and inclusive environment, committed to empowering associates and celebrating diverse perspectives.
What you will do
- Design, develop, and implement a new React/Redux-based frontend for the SFCM platform.
- Work with Java backend developers to design and implement scalable backend services for seamless integration.
- Collaborate with UX/UI designers, product owners, and stakeholders to create intuitive user experiences.
- Lead code reviews, technical sessions, and provide hands-on mentorship to build team competence.
- Partner with QA and DevOps teams to align development with quality, security, and regulatory requirements specific to financial services.
- Implement secure coding standards and manage authentication/authorization flows for financial services.
Requirements
- Education: Bachelor’s or Master’s Degree in Engineering, Computer Science/IT, or related field required.
- 8+ years of professional development experience, with 3+ years in frontend development with modern frameworks and service-oriented Java backend.
- Strong experience with React, Redux, JavaScript, and TypeScript.
- Proficient in state management (Context API or Redux) and data grids (e.g., AG Grid).
- Skilled in CSS (e.g., styled-components) and proficient in building/integrating RESTful APIs.
- Background in Spring Boot and core Java development.
- Ability to guide an existing development team and communicate effectively.
Nice to have
- C++ development experience.
- Familiarity with web-based testing practices (automation).
- Experience working within an Agile squad model.
- Experience deploying and hosting web applications in production.
Culture & Benefits
- Fostering a collaborative, engaging, and inclusive environment.
- Committed to providing a workplace that empowers associates to be authentic.
- Dedicated to recognizing and celebrating everyone’s unique perspective.
Будьте осторожны: если вас просят войти в iCloud/Google, прислать код/пароль, запустить код/ПО, не делайте этого - это мошенники. Обязательно жмите "Пожаловаться" или пишите в поддержку. Подробнее в гайде →